More Information About The Item

This Lego lunchbox is made from polypropylene –the same material used by the Lego Group to make the bricks and the minifigs. Make sure however to wash the lunchbox before using it for the first time and then wash it after use after that.

Dimensions:

This lunchbox measures about 7.5cm x 10cm x 20cm –truly small enough to fit into your kids’ school bags or backpacks.
